Windstar Cruises announces limited-time all-inclusive upgrade across worldwide sailings

Star Legend, Windstar Cruises

Windstar Cruises has announced the launch of a limited-time complimentary All-Inclusive offer, inviting travellers to experience its small-ship cruising style with added value across global itineraries.

The promotion is available on select sailings booked between April 1 and June 30, 2026, for travel through June 30, 2027. It includes Wi-Fi, gratuities, and unlimited select cocktails, wine by the glass and beer, with a combined value of over USD 1,300 on a seven-day voyage for two guests.

The offer enhances Windstar’s boutique cruising experience, which focuses on intimate yachts carrying between 148 and 342 guests. Designed to deliver a more personalised and immersive journey, the small-ship format enables access to lesser-known ports, city centres and hidden harbours that are typically inaccessible to larger vessels.

Windstar’s approach to cruising places emphasis on extended time in port, flexibility and curated experiences. Guests can engage in activities such as paddleboarding directly from the yacht’s Marina, joining market tours with local chefs, or enjoying late-evening stays ashore. As the Official Cruise Line of the James Beard Foundation, the company also integrates destination-inspired culinary and wine experiences onboard.

The All-Inclusive offer applies across Windstar’s global portfolio, covering a wide range of itineraries and regions. These include year-round sailings in Europe and the Mediterranean, South Pacific voyages in Tahiti and French Polynesia, as well as itineraries across Greece, the Canary Islands and Alaska. Select specialty sailings, including Grand Prix, Eclipse and Mystery cruises, are excluded from the promotion.
